2757  Other / Beginners & Help / Re: IMPORTANT NEWBIES ADVICE! For your own safety! on: October 19, 2019, 01:53:09 PM
NEVER LET UNKNOWN ENTITIES CONNECT TO YOUR PC WITH REMOTE CONTROL LIKE TEAM VIEWER.

Risks are enormous and could lead to total loss of your funds and/or compromise your data permanently.

Stay aware, stay safe.  Smiley

If you are smart enough, you will not let anyone scam you through team viewer if he is operating the screen in front of you. We should be knowing how to use the software correctly.
Even if you are using team viewer, you should have complete knowledge of it. There is one feature which is called "Unattended access" whereby you just give your partner one time password and the next time he can connect with you PC even if you are not on the PC. So never enable that option.
If you take proper precautions, then you will be safe.
2758  Other / Beginners & Help / Re: Beware of ponzi schemes bearing names relating to bitcoin on social media on: October 19, 2019, 01:41:28 PM
I will want to draw attention of newbies towards this scam on social media, the wide popularity of bitcoin is an advantage for criminals.
I got a message from an anonymous person on whatsapp offering me an opportunity to invest in bitcoin and earn twice your investment in no time, this guys confuses you with fake chat of others claiming to have been paid from the investment, which I knew where altered and I did the rightful thing by blocking the person.
I would like to call on newbies not to fall victim on social media in the name of investing in bitcoin
If you willing to invest in bitcoin you can get bitcoin wallet and go to an exchange where you can buy bitcoin and keep in your wallet, very easy.
Planning to double your money in a day through bitcoin on social media is at your own risk there is hardly such type of investment being genuine

Its not only limited to the Newbies but sometimes even the experienced in crypto fell for this scam. It is presented in such a way, that for a moment anyone would be tempted to double their money in no time, but these types of schemes are fraud.



I got a message from an anonymous person on whatsapp offering me an opportunity to invest in bitcoin and earn twice your investment in no time...

If someone contacted you through WhatsApp that means you were careless with your mobile phone number, just as you are careless with your e-mail that is displayed publicly through your profile. One of the most important steps is not to make such information public, otherwise you give anyone a chance to contact you and try to deceive you in any way.

Bad people use all possible methods to find their potential victims, and social networks, e-mails, mobile phones are ideal platforms for modern scams. Do not share such data publicly, do not trust unknown people who contact you to make money and you will be safe.

Getting a phone number is not too difficult for the like minded people. If you are a trader, you must have joined few whatsapp trading signal groups and your phone number is easily visible. Also people can send messages on random numbers hoping to get some victims.
